Oil India Limited donates Critical Care Ambulance
Noida. Oil India Limited,has donated an Ambulance fitted with Critical Care facilities,to the Noida Medicare Centre,for the benefit of the underprivileged and needy people of the society in and around Noida. The Ambulance was flagged off by Sri Utpal Bora, Chairman and Managing Director, Oil India Limited in presence of Directors on the Board of Oil India Limited and Sri G.C. Vaishnav, MD, Noida Medicare Centre, yesterday.
